Specialized ICs NXP Semiconductors BUK9614-60E,118 Overview

The Specialized ICs NXP Semiconductors BUK9614-60E,118 is an advanced power MOSFET designed specifically for high-efficiency, high-speed switching applications. Featuring a low on-state resistance of only 12.8mΩ at 10V, this component ensures minimal power loss and superior thermal performance, making it ideal for energy-sensitive setups. Its robust design includes a maximum drain-to-source voltage of 60V, accommodating a broad range of operating conditions. The device's high-speed switching capabilities are underpinned by a rapid turn-off delay time of just 35.7 ns, enhancing its performance in high-frequency applications. The BUK9614-60E,118 is housed in a TO-263-3, D2Pak package, offering excellent durability and ease of mounting in dense circuit designs.
